Abstract

The utility model discloses a guide rail protective cover for a numerically-controlled machine tool, comprising a protective belt, a protective cover main body, guide rail holes and a spring shaft. The guide rail protective cover is characterized in that the spring shaft is connected on the protective belt, the protective cover main body is connected on the spring shaft, the guide rail holes are provided in the middle of the protective cover main body, and the guide rail holes run through the interior of the protective cover main body. The guide rail protective cover for the numerically-controlled machine tool is simple in structure, is anti-wear, high-temperature and high-pressure resistant, waterproof and anti-corrosion, and is not easy to damage, so that the guide rail for the numerically-controlled machine tool can be protected effectively.

Description

A kind of numerical control machine slide rail protective cover
Technical field
The utility model relates to the Digit Control Machine Tool field, relates in particular to a kind of numerical control machine slide rail protective cover.
Background technology
Along with the 21 century informationization, the arrival of automation, and the more and more faster economic development situation of reality society, cause numerical control device to be popularized fast, because the manufacturing process of interests modern technologies makes that the manufacturing cost of these equipment has obtained reducing greatly, also have because the cost of present human resources improves greatly, and the reasons such as inefficiency of the expansion of personnel's management cost and artificial operation in enterprise produces, slowly bring into use numerical control device to replace artificial troublesome operation so enterprise gets more and more at production, yet numerical control machine slide rail have the shortcoming of easy damage in numerical control device uses.
At present, various numerical control machine slide rail protective covers are arranged in numerical control machine slide rail protective cover field, as the type protective cover of scaffolding dismantling; Overlap joint extension-type shelter etc.; but these numerical control machine slide rail protective roof structure complexity; made by cast iron; has the non-refractory high pressure; corrosion easily; how therefore easy shortcoming such as damages effectively protected numerical control machine slide rail and protected this just to need us can find an effective solution.
Summary of the invention
Technical problem to be solved in the utility model provides a kind of simple in structure, anti-wear, high temperature high voltage resistant, waterproof anti-corrosion, and is not fragile, can effectively protect the numerical control machine slide rail protective cover of numerical control machine slide rail.
For solving the problems of the technologies described above, the utility model provides a kind of numerical control machine slide rail protective cover, comprise buffer zone, protective cover main body, guide rail hole, spring shaft, it is characterized in that: be connected with spring shaft on the described buffer zone, be connected with the protective cover main body on the described spring shaft, offer guide rail hole in the middle of the described protective cover main body, described guide rail hole is in protecting cover.
Further, described buffer zone is made by stainless steel.
Further, described protective cover main body is made by stainless steel, is rectangular structure.
Compared with prior art, the beneficial effects of the utility model are: the utlity model has simple in structure, anti-wear, high temperature high voltage resistant, waterproof anti-corrosion, and not fragile, can effectively protect numerical control machine slide rail.

The specific embodiment
Below in conjunction with the drawings and specific embodiments the utility model is described in further details
Referring to shown in Figure 1; a kind of numerical control machine slide rail protective cover; comprise buffer zone 1, protective cover main body 2, guide rail hole 3, spring shaft 4; be connected with spring shaft 4 on the described buffer zone 1; be connected with protective cover main body 2 on the described spring shaft 4; offer guide rail hole 3 in the middle of the described protective cover main body 2; described guide rail hole 3 is in protective cover main body 2; described buffer zone 1 is made by stainless steel material; described protective cover main body 2 is also made by stainless steel material; and be rectangular structure, described protective cover main body 2 makes it not fragile for the protection of numerical control machine slide rail.
To sum up, the utility model is simple in structure, anti-wear, high temperature high voltage resistant, waterproof anti-corrosion, and is not fragile, can effectively protect numerical control machine slide rail.
